The clerk’s office provides forms for filing claims. ... the advice of … WebSuing someone in Magistrate Court is a “small claim.”. 1. The Magistrate Court can only give you a judgment for money that is owed you—it can’t order someone to do or not do something. 2. The amount of money involved must be $15,000.00 or less. 3.

WebMagistrate Court. Magistrate court, also called small claims court, is an informal court that handles money claims of less than $15,000. This court offers a quick and inexpensive process to resolve complaints. Examples of problems often taken to magistrate court include: A tenant refusing to pay for damages in excess of the security deposit. WebSmall Claims Forms. Forms. Filing Fees.
